Guided Tour in E-MTB to Gran Sasso National Park

Assergi Trip Overview

Unique experience for nature and E-MTB lovers.
With the professionalism and assistance of the bike-guide you will have the opportunity to explore the Gran Sasso trails in total safety on a comfortable E-MTB all mountain of the latest generation, to get to know places of historical and cultural interest and taste food and wine specialties.
The excursion will stop in one of the most beautiful villages in Italy, Santo Stefano di Sessanio and the Castle of Rocca Calascio, one of the 15 most beautiful castles in the world for National Geographic, where short stops are planned. On the way back it will be possible to rest while tasting roasts and other typical local products at the Montecristo refuge.
Necessary equipment: helmet, mountain shoes, gloves, sunglasses, shorts with back, long socks, backpack, at least 1 liter of water, bars, sunscreen, raincoat and long-sleeved shirt.
A good athletic preparation is required and halves the use of bicycles.

Additional Info

Duration: 5 to 6 hours
Starts: Assergi, Italy

Itinerary
This is a typical itinerary for this product

Stop At: Santo Stefano di Sessanio, Santo Stefano di Sessanio, Province of L’Aquila, Abruzzo

Departure from Fonte Cerreto at 10.00 am along a mountain path for about 10 km that leads to the Locce di Santo Stefano, a plateau where the lentil is grown at high altitude, a typical local product. After another 5 km along a dirt road we reach one of the most beautiful villages in ITALY: Santo Stefano di Sessanio, which we will visit on our return from Rocca Calascio, only 5 km away.

Duration: 2 hours

Stop At: Rocca Calascio, Via Di Pizzo Falcone, 67020 Calascio Italy

The medieval castle of Rocca Calascio has been ranked by National Geographic among the 15 most beautiful castles in the world and has been the set of numerous film productions, such as Lady Hawke.

Duration: 30 minutes

Stop At: Parco Nazionale del Gran Sasso e Monti della Laga, Via del Convento 1, 67100 Assergi Italy

From the fortress you can admire a unique landscape: on one side the Corno Grande massif, on the other the Majella and under the vaIle of Tirino, where the Montepulciano d’Abruzzo is produced. After a short stop in Calascio we return to Santo Stefano for a quick visit of the village. At about 2.30 p.m. we return to the MonteCristo refuge where you can rest while tasting the typical local products.

Duration: 50 minutes
